Simplifying 52 + 4x = 124 Solving 52 + 4x = 124 Solving for variable 'x'.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'-52' to each side of the equation. 52 + -52 + 4x = 124 + -52 Combine like terms: 52 + -52 = 0 0 + 4x = 124 + -52 4x = 124 + -52 Combine like terms: 124 + -52 = 72 4x = 72 Divide each side by '4'. x = 18 Simplifying x = 18
